Leadership Review Briefing — Licensing Dispute

Heads-up for the finance team before Thursday's review: the disagreement with Quillmark Devices over the Solace firmware licence has escalated. They claim our Meridian update falls outside the original scope; our counsel disagrees, but settlement talk is on the table. Worst case, we're looking at a one-off charge plus revised royalty terms going forward — please have scenario numbers ready. Nobody wants a courtroom fight over this. How this fits into our wider plans is outlined in the note below.

board note of fahif-yahog: Gross margin on Wenath came in at 10 percent against a plan of 5 percent. Only 3 of the 100 pilot accounts renewed Wenath, so a churn review is set for July 15.

Internal memo — Returned demo units

To the dispatch desk: four Quellan S2 demo units have come back from the Bramford showroom and are awaiting inspection in bay three. Each unit has been logged, photographed, and sealed by the returns clerk. They are to be forwarded to the refurbishment team at Windlecote on the next scheduled run, with the courier hand-over following the confidential instruction below.

dispatch memo: the lamwyn fenwyn courier leaves the wenir ledger at gate 7175 under passcode 822969

v3.2.0 — Spoolbird printer-spooler service: we renamed the old QUEUE_KEY setting because it collided with the scheduler's variable of the same name. The service now ignores the old name entirely, so don't just copy forward last release's env file. Add the renamed queue credential on the line directly below this sentence.

vault entry, kagep-yajeg: COURIER_KEY5=da097